> The navigator.getUserMedia api has been deprecated and updated to be 
> navigator.mediaDevices.getUserMedia. After looking at the camera plugin today 
> and how it works with the browser target it seems that the camera plugin 
> still uses the deprecated version of the api. While the old api is currently 
> still supported along with the new version of the api in Chrome and Firefox, 
> it is due to be removed asap, which would in turn break the current version 
> of the camera plugin.
